“QUIET PLEASE, THERE'S A LADY ON STAGE” Jeanne Pratt AC, Chairman of The Production Company, announces her Company's 20th Birthday Season, starring ROHAN BROWNE, MITCHELL BUTEL, BOBBY FOX, SIMON GLEESON, NANCYE HAYES, GENEVIEVE KINGSFORD, AMY LEHPAMER, MATTHEW MANAHAN, ELISE MCCANN, BEN MINGAY, ROBYN NEVIN, ANNA O'BYRNE, CAROLINE O'CONNOR, RICHARD PIPER AND CHRIS RYAN.

Jeanne Pratt AC said “I started The Production Company 20 years ago to provide opportunit­ies for Australia's extraordin­ary talent. Now as I look back on the hundreds of artists who have worked with us, it's a veritable Who's Who of musical theatre. We've produced 58 musicals in Melbourne, won multiple awards and toured interstate. Our shows have thrilled audiences of more than 600,000! I couldn't be more proud. And now for our 20th birthday we're celebratin­g with three of our favourites.

The Rodgers & Hammerstei­n masterpiec­e OKLAHOMA! starts the Season.

THE BOY FROM OZ also turns 20 in 2018 and to celebrate our joint birthdays we're staging a brand new production. And finally an Australian premiere, A GENTLEMAN'S GUIDE TO LOVE & MURDER, all at Arts Centre Melbourne. With a landmark line up of stars, come and celebrate 20 wonderful years with Melbourne's very own musical theatre company. I'll see you at the theatre.”

OKLAHOMA! OPENS IN ARTS CENTRE MELBOURNE'S STATE THEATRE ON MAY 26 FOR A SEASON OF 11 PERFORMANC­ES.

Rodgers & Hammerstei­n's masterpiec­e OKLAHOMA! revolution­ised the American musical; the first of their legendary shows, it won a Pulitzer Prize and set the standard for modern musicals. It tells the story of the Oklahoma Territory at the start of the twentieth century and of Curly, a farmer who loves Laurey. But Laurey's not so sure about Curly and wonders if she really loves Jud. And Will loves Ado Annie, but Annie loves…well, everybody.

PRESENTED IN ASSOCIATIO­N WITH VIEW FILMS AND ROBERT FOX LTD, THE BOY FROM OZ OPENS IN ARTS CENTRE MELBOURNE'S STATE THEATRE ON AUGUST 11 FOR A SEASON OF 11 PERFORMANC­ES.

THE BOY FROM OZ is the dazzling, funny and moving story of the beloved Australian entertaine­r, Peter Allen. From singing in pubs at 11, to teenage stardom on television, he was discovered by Judy Garland and went on to marry her daughter Liza Minnelli. Peter achieved global stardom as a performer and multi award winning songwriter.

A GENTLEMAN'S GUIDE TO LOVE & MURDER OPENS IN ARTS CENTRE MELBOURNE'S PLAYHOUSE THEATRE ON OCTOBER 27 FOR A SEASON OF 18 PERFORMANC­ES.

A GENTLEMAN'S GUIDE TO LOVE & MURDER is a brand new, drop-dead musical comedy about Monty, a penniless clerk who discovers he is ninth in line to be Lord D'Ysquith, the Earl of Highhurst. But the D'Ysquith family dismiss his claim then curiously the eight family members in line to be Earl start dying from unnatural causes! Meanwhile Monty woos money-minded Sibella but also finds himself drawn to young Phoebe D'Ysquith…what could possibly go wrong?
